Does Alopecia Capsule Make Hair Grow?
Hair loss, otherwise known as alopecia, is an increasingly common problem experienced by men and women alike. While many treatments exist, such as topical ointments, shampoos, and laser therapy, some people may be interested in trying a capsule-based treatment. So, does an alopecia capsule make hair grow?
Alopecia is an autoimmune disorder that causes hair loss from the scalp and other areas of the body. It can be caused by a variety of factors, including genetics, hormonal imbalances, certain medications, and stress.
Capsules are a type of medication that is usually taken orally. They can be used to treat a variety of conditions, including alopecia. Capsules typically contain vitamins, minerals, and herbs that are believed to help promote hair growth.
The answer to the question of whether an alopecia capsule makes hair grow depends on the individual. While some capsules may contain ingredients that could potentially stimulate hair growth, there is no scientific evidence to support the claim that they are effective in treating alopecia. Additionally, capsules may carry the risk of side effects, some of which could be serious. Therefore, it is important to consult with a doctor before using any capsule-based treatment for alopecia.
